Vraag kan gnome-terminal niet openen in de normale gebruikersmodus vanuit de rootgebruikersmodus


Wanneer ik de opdracht "gnome-terminal" als root-gebruiker opneem, wordt alleen een nieuwe terminal geopend in de rootgebruikersmodus. Nu is mijn vraag: "Is er een manier om een ​​nieuwe terminal te openen in de normale gebruikersmodus, zelfs als we de opdracht 'gnome-terminal' uit de rootgebruikersmodus geven? '

"'xyz #' gnome-terminal"        zou een nieuwe terminal moeten openen met de prompt "xyz: ~ $".


1
2017-07-23 13:52


oorsprong


Klik gewoon op Ctrl + Alt + T, want wanneer terminal werkt als root, verwacht het niet dat er een Terminal-venster voor een andere gebruiker wordt geopend (u!) - SimplySimon


antwoorden:


Gebruik suen log in met uw account:

su - yourUserName -c 'gnome-terminal'

Als alternatief kunt u de runuseropdracht:

runuser -l  yourUserName -c 'gnome-terminal'

1
2017-07-23 13:55



Dat is niet wat runuser is voor. Gebruik su of sudo. - Zenexer